Based in Gevrey-Chambertin, Denis Mortet is a family-owned estate run by Laurence Mortet and her two children, Clémence and Arnaud. The Domaine was originally founded in 1956 by Charles Mortet with just a single hectare of vines to his name. This release comes from the prestigious Grand Cru Chambertin, where Mortet owns a 0.15-hectare parcel of 60-year-old vines. These are some of the best reds from the uneven 2001 vintage, showing great purity and expression of vineyard character.
92 Vinous
Full, bright red. Brooding, very ripe aromas of black fruits, licorice, graphite and gunflint, all lifted by a subtle oaky perfume. Big, broad, rich and okay, with powerful, dense black fruit flavors and excellent length and thrust. Five or six years in bottle should bring greater refinement as the wine loses some of its baby fat.Stephen Tanzer1st March 2004
